Output 3d3bbd0177519c8b63d3a0e06681aaf41285c043108bc9bd9aba1250f4fb0d1a:0

value
21359657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35d7017660ad3e8ee373718611479ed89879d175 OP_EQUALVERIFY OP_CHECKSIG
address
15ugP2Vr1HWVuhm2ACG9aqX4rqY1tE1rkY
transaction
3d3bbd0177519c8b63d3a0e06681aaf41285c043108bc9bd9aba1250f4fb0d1a
confirmations
234287
spent
true